Stability of Amphotericin B in Infusion Bottles
AUTOR(ES)
Block, Edward R.
RESUMO
Intravenous solutions of amphotericin B in 5% dextrose water with or without hydrocortisone or heparin demonstrated no appreciable loss of activity when exposed to fluorescent light for up to 24 h at 25 C (room temperature).
